    Glad to see new content rolling out. It looks neat! One suggestion: could you guys please find a way to award experience points on a continuous basis other than adventuring? Maybe award points for maintaining a balanced production for some period of time. I know we get achievements and there are quest-lines that are production based, but once those are completed that's it. With adventures the number of times you can collect the XP is endless and players can select to do them whenever their resources and time allow, it would be cool if there were non-adv based ways we could choose from as well. There could be linked resource activity sets like activating a "bake off" activity where we have to maintain a bread production chain for at least 60 minutes and sell 1k each of wheat, flour and bread, and the activity could have a timer where we have to complete all the requirements within 24 hours (just as a suggestion of an activity set). Another way could be to activate any previously completed main quest and collect its XP (example: "Pinewood Planks Productions" main quest would award a total of 362 XP).

    Just spent a few minutes on test. Playing with the "Oven of Truth" was fun. Hoping for ways to gather crystals in addition to login bonus and daily quests since the elite tab on the oven costs 4 crystals. Login bonus for day one is 1 crystal, daily quest was 3. Might take quite a while to get the 12 letter fragments needed for an elite adventure at that rate. Wish I had more time to play on test this month!!
